Ryoyu Kobayashi flies 291-meter off Ski Jump, Smashes World Record

To break the ski jump and ski flying world records, you need a hill bigger than standard competition ski jumps. Olympic medalist and FIS World Cup Champion Ryōyū Kobayashi and his team headed to Akureyri in northern Iceland, and carved a special kicker out of snow on the side of the mountain with the single intention of creating a jump big enough to smash world records…
